In court documents, the estate claimed Phillips had improperly taken items and attempted to sell the property years later.
The filings said the items included “roughly 109 CDs/DVDs, most of which either contain handwritten notes on them or are private special editions,” personal and legal papers, handwritten notes, 5 hard drives, a microphone set, a photo album with Jackson on the cover, 3 silver Mac laptops, two iPods, two Dictaphones with 2 micro-cassettes, and 3 standards cassette tapes.
